help me tried fix my nav system
hello to everyone.
When i bought my Z4, the nav LCD doesn't worked well, something was broken in the mechanism that rises and down the LCD. I had to use the hands to lift the Lcd, but the screen and everything else worked well (gps, trip computer, stereo, etc) I disassembled and tried to fix the mechanism with some epoxy. But I forgot where I should put an 1 wire harness connector. There are 2 similar conectors but I dont know where I must put it. Other fact, I already assembled the LCD and install in my Z4, but when I turn On, the nav lcd doesnt work . The screen doesn't turn on, the lcd doens't rise . |

While they may fit in both, I think you'll find they click into only one. You can see that each female fitting has a notch on the side that is opposite each other.
The male should also have a side notch. But the female will click onto the male when inserted the correct way (I hope). Maybe try one connector in each, then tug on it. The one that's harder to remove the male from should be the correct one. But I haven't taken this apart myself so it's only a guess. good luck
